HVMG, or Highgate Hospitality Management Group, is a prominent hotel management company recognized for its commitment to excellence and fostering a culture of growth and opportunity. The organization operates a diverse portfolio of hotels nationwide and is renowned for its focus on providing exceptional guest experiences and supporting employee career development. HVMG's corporate environment thrives on a strong "Be Excellent" culture, which emphasizes professionalism, positive attitudes, and dedicated service. This culture encourages associates to excel in their roles and climb the ranks within the organization, offering promising career opportunities regardless of where an employee starts on the organizational chart. Job Requirements

  • eligible to work in the United States
  • sufficient education and literacy to read product labels and communicate with guests
  • physical ability to sit, stand, bend, kneel, and lift as required with or without accommodations
  • availability to work flexible schedules including evenings, weekends, and holidays
  • professional demeanor with a warm and positive attitude

Job Qualifications

  • previous experience as an executive chef
  • experience in similar or related culinary positions
  • combination of education and hands-on experience
  • completion of culinary certifications or diploma preferred
  • strong leadership and communication skills
  • ability to manage a team effectively

Job Duties

  • overseeing menu creation and development
  • managing food preparation processes
  • supervising kitchen staff and operations
  • ensuring exceptional food quality and presentation
  • maintaining cleanliness and kitchen safety standards
  • collaborating with the Director of Food & Beverage and General Manager
  • innovating dishes to enhance guest dining experience
